						<section><p>In addition to the powers granted in &#xA7;&#xA0;<a class="law" title="General powers and duties of health regulatory boards" href="/54.1-2400/">54.1-2400</a>, the <span class="dictionary">Board</span> shall have the following specific powers and duties:</p></section>
						<section id="1"><p><span class="prefix-number">1.</span> To cooperate with and maintain a close liaison with other professional <span class="dictionary">boards</span> and the community to ensure that regulatory systems <span class="dictionary">stay</span> abreast of community and professional needs. <a id="paragraph-209123" class="section-permalink" href="https://vacode.org/54.1-3705/#1"><i class="fa fa-link"/></a></p></section>
						<section id="2"><p><span class="prefix-number">2.</span> To conduct inspections to ensure that licensees conduct their practices in a competent manner and in conformance with the relevant regulations. <a id="paragraph-209124" class="section-permalink" href="https://vacode.org/54.1-3705/#2"><i class="fa fa-link"/></a></p></section>
						<section id="3"><p><span class="prefix-number">3.</span> To designate specialties within the profession. <a id="paragraph-209125" class="section-permalink" href="https://vacode.org/54.1-3705/#3"><i class="fa fa-link"/></a></p></section>
						<section id="4"><p><span class="prefix-number">4.</span> Expired. <a id="paragraph-209126" class="section-permalink" href="https://vacode.org/54.1-3705/#4"><i class="fa fa-link"/></a></p></section>
						<section id="5"><p><span class="prefix-number">5.</span> To license <span class="dictionary">baccalaureate social workers</span>, master&#x2019;s social workers, and <span class="dictionary">clinical social workers</span> to practice consistent with the requirements of the chapter and regulations of the <span class="dictionary">Board</span>. <a id="paragraph-209127" class="section-permalink" href="https://vacode.org/54.1-3705/#5"><i class="fa fa-link"/></a></p></section>
						<section id="6"><p><span class="prefix-number">6.</span> To register persons proposing to obtain supervised post-degree experience in the <span class="dictionary">practice of social work</span> required by the <span class="dictionary">Board</span> for licensure as a <span class="dictionary">clinical social worker</span>. <a id="paragraph-209128" class="section-permalink" href="https://vacode.org/54.1-3705/#6"><i class="fa fa-link"/></a></p></section>
						<section id="7"><p><span class="prefix-number">7.</span> To pursue the establishment of reciprocal agreements with <span class="dictionary">jurisdictions</span> that are contiguous with the Commonwealth for the licensure of <span class="dictionary">baccalaureate social workers</span>, master&#x2019;s social workers, and <span class="dictionary">clinical social workers</span>. Reciprocal agreements shall require that a person hold a comparable, current, unrestricted license in the other <span class="dictionary">jurisdiction</span> and that no grounds exist for denial based on the Code of Virginia and regulations of the <span class="dictionary">Board</span>. <a id="paragraph-209129" class="section-permalink" href="https://vacode.org/54.1-3705/#7"><i class="fa fa-link"/></a></p></section>
						<section id="8"><p><span class="prefix-number">8.</span> To maintain on the <span class="dictionary">Board</span>&#x2019;s website a list of the names and contact information of persons currently approved by the <span class="dictionary">Board</span> to supervise candidates for licensure as a <span class="dictionary">clinical social worker</span>. <a id="paragraph-209130" class="section-permalink" href="https://vacode.org/54.1-3705/#8"><i class="fa fa-link"/></a></p></section>
						<section id="9"><p><span class="prefix-number">9.</span> To allow supervisees pursuing licensure as a <span class="dictionary">clinical social worker</span> to change or add a supervisor from the <span class="dictionary">Board</span>&#x2019;s list of currently approved supervisors without prior approval from the <span class="dictionary">Board</span>. <a id="paragraph-209131" class="section-permalink" href="https://vacode.org/54.1-3705/#9"><i class="fa fa-link"/></a></p></section></text><history>1976, c. 608, &#xA7;&#xA7; 54-929, 54-931; 1983, c. 115; 1986, cc. 64, 100, 464; 1988, c. 765; 1994, c. 778; 2018, c. 451; 2020, c. 617; 2023, c. 489.</history><metadata></metadata></law>
